City postpones adoption of new emissions rules
    2019-09-16  08:53    Shenzhen Daily

THE adoption of more stringent vehicle emissions standards will be postponed.

The National VI emissions standards had been scheduled to be implemented July 1. However, the Shenzhen vehicle administration authority announced Saturday that vehicles that meet National V emissions standards will still be eligible for registration in Shenzhen until Sept. 30.

National V vehicles should meet one of the following conditions to be eligible for registration: sold before June 30 with a unified receipt; owner has already finished a procedure to transfer the car’s plates from another city (cities in the Pearl River Delta not included) to Shenzhen before June 30; a new car waiting to be sold at a car dealership in Guangdong with a product certificate issued before June 30; an imported car with all procedures concluded before June 30.

Additionally, National V cars that are currently being used with license plates registered in the Pearl River Delta area can be re-registered in Shenzhen before June 30, 2023.   (Wang Jingli)
